Transaction 42ce8b8b2832f98545be1e9b45fde53ea8cb9acae0d7127e60e05c75941427b1

10 Input
2 Outputs
  • 42ce8b8b2832f98545be1e9b45fde53ea8cb9acae0d7127e60e05c75941427b1:0
  • value  21514748
    address  3Q2pAaictWcr37cSZToZSjtrLaLmoTvSay
  • 42ce8b8b2832f98545be1e9b45fde53ea8cb9acae0d7127e60e05c75941427b1:1
  • value  1407012
    address  3H5HdtryHcbowAgY8ThAs5Lnkm7fhm5UQA